Many people have prophecied Ezekiel 37, "The Valley of Dry Bones" over Austria. I would extend this to Europe as a whole. In that story, the Lord leads Ezekiel to a valley full of dry, long-dead bones, and tells him to prophecy life over them. As he does, the bones begin to rattle and move, to reassemble and grow flesh, until they are no longer bones but a vast army of living people. The word here for Europe is "You were once alive and now you're dead- come to life again!" In this powerful, beautiful continent there is such heritage for greatness in the faith, and right now, so many dry bones, waiting to be brought back to life. Some of them may be just beginning to rattle.
